  • Chipotle Mexican Grill (NYSE:CMG) is rolling out a one hour global buy one get one promotion aimed at customers with tattoos.
  • The campaign is tied to tattoo culture and features a collaboration with music artist Swae Lee.
  • This flash deal comes as the company faces scrutiny for limited discounting during a period of weaker same store sales and softer foot traffic.

Chipotle Mexican Grill, known for its fast casual burrito and bowl format, has generally focused on pricing power, digital ordering and menu simplicity rather than heavy discounting. The new BOGO promotion stands out because it reaches across multiple countries and directly targets a specific fan segment, tattooed customers, instead of broad price cutting. For investors, it raises questions about how the brand is thinking about value, traffic and customer engagement.

The collaboration with Swae Lee and the focus on tattoo culture indicate that Chipotle is emphasizing cultural relevance and exclusivity to create buzz around a limited time offer rather than resetting its everyday pricing stance. Key Considerations

  • 📊 The global BOGO tattoo promotion looks like an attempt to support traffic without shifting the everyday pricing stance. This may matter if weaker same store sales persist.
  • 📊 Watch whether management comments on traffic, average check size and any follow on promotions in upcoming updates to see if this campaign becomes a pattern.
  • ⚠️ The key risk is that heavy promotional buzz does not translate into sustained visit frequency. This could leave margins under pressure if discount activity ramps up further.
